Austin Drone City: UAVs for Public Good

Description:

Recent tragic events including an active shooter at a Las Vegas concert and the bombing at the Boston Marathon illustrate how public events can quickly escalate into a life threatening situations.
Austin is a vibrant & progressive community that annually serves as host to many multi-day events that bring 10’s of thousands of attendees to its city. However, hosting events such as ACL Live, Formula 1 and of course the SXSW festivals creates significant challenges for local public safety organizations that must ensure the safe and secure environment for event attendees.
In our panel of Austin public safety leaders, we will discuss the use emerging technologies to better enable and prepare their organizations to rapidly respond to any type of public safety threat for event attendees.


Related Media


Takeaways

  1. Learn about the ever increasing public safety threat landscape and how first response organizations try to stay a step ahead of the bad actors.
  2. Better understand how new emerging technologies such as UAVs are becoming the first eyes and ears in emergency response situations.
  3. Learn about virtual policing of public gatherings. UAVs could be used to better assist with control crowd control by acting as a high tech deterrent.
